In addition to these stunning lakes, Lake Cerknica stands out as a unique destination due to its intermittent nature. This lake fills and empties depending on the season, creating a dynamic landscape that attracts nature lovers and birdwatchers alike. What is the best time to visit Slovenia’s lake resorts?
The best time to visit is during the late spring to early autumn months, from May to September, when the weather is warm and ideal for outdoor activities. However, winter also offers a unique charm with opportunities for snow sports.
How can I reach the lake resorts in Slovenia?
Lake resorts in Slovenia are accessible by car, bus, or train, with good connections from major cities like Ljubljana. Many resorts also offer shuttle services for guests arriving at nearby airports.
